Recently was held a study visit to projects carried in Cahul namely - "Rehabilitation of leisure and entertainment area "Salt Lake" and "The rehabilitation and modernization of the road of regional importance - str. I. Spirin in Cahul".

Director of Department for Regional Development, MDRC, Valerian Binzaru, convened a meeting with local authorities in Cahul.  At common informational meeting attended by representatives of MDRC, Mayor of Cahul Nicholae Dandis, chief architect of Cahul, the project manager, general contractor and representatives of RDA South. The purpose of the meeting was to inform, to attract attention to the deficiencies of this process of works, on finding constructive solutions and respectively cooperation with the newly formed local governments.


Meeting in Cahul was organized within the project " Rehabilitation of leisure and entertainment area "Salt Lake" which will help to develop the infrastructure of tourism leisure in Southern Region and" Rehabilitation and modernization of the road of regional importance - I. Spirin in Cahul„ in order of sustainable and balanced economic growth of the South Region.

Also, was performed  the monitoring visit at Taraclia, in order to examine the situation within the project ” Improvement the road L654 through capital repair”  which connect the settlements Ceadîr - Lunga, Corten, Taraclia. It was found that at the moment construction works are made entirely on an area of 1, 5 km, and the funds allocated for 2015 (10 mln.lei) were fully valorized by the general contractor. Additionally were made works in value over 10 mln.lei.  

The projects listed above are included in the Unique Program Document and are financed from sources NFRD.
